Assistant Merchandiser London
Overview As Assistant Merchandiser on our Footwear team, you will deliver category retail performance objectives through inventory management, availability planning and performance analysis. What you'll be doing Planning Provides accurate analysis to aid the development of the category strategy, retail range planning and promotional calendar Uses lessons learnt to assist in building Store Profile Ranges on Range Vis and Line Buys at appropriate level Completes size analysis and uses to size future orders Size curves are set for each store profile as part of product buying process Initial store allocations to be set up and reflect product grading sign offs Ensures regional retail line cards are reforecasted and up to date, recommending additional order requirements, phasing changes or potential cancellations for Junior Planner or Planner to approve Assists Planner in optimising retail availability, notably on Best Sellers, maximising sales and profit, ensuring sufficient stocks are held at all times Managing Supply Chain & Critical Path Reviewing PTS, ensuring accuracy of process across the entire retail category, checking stock due to ship is sufficient ( and not excess stock) is shipped to MW warehouses and highlights concerns to the team Communicates PTS amends to the supplier where required Ensures regional retail intake availability in line with promotional and season launch dates, and forecasted sales demand Works across functions to manage the promotional critical path and keeps trackers accurate and up to date Updates system with changes agreed by JP/P, communicating to suppliers Manages Self and Others Trains new team members across own team and wider merchandising function Seeks opportunities and initiates own development Develop and maintains positive cross functional and external relationships Identifies process opportunities for improving efficiencies and
